The hexadecimal color code #EC035E corresponds to the code RGB( 236, 3, 94 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,93 level), green (at 0,01 level) and blue (at 0,37 level). Its brightness is 46% and its saturation is 97%. It is composed of red at 70%, green at 0% and blue at 28%. The dominant component is red.
